21. εἶπεν οὖν. He said therefore: because now they were able to receive it. Their alarm was dispelled and they knew that He was the Lord. He repeats His message of ‘Peace.’ For ἀπέσταλκεν and πέμπω see on Joh 1:33. Christ’s mission is henceforth to be carried on by His disciples. He is ὁ ἀπόστολος (Heb 3:1), even as they are ἀπόστολοι. The close correspondence between the two missions is shewn by καθώς, even as (Joh 17:18). Note the present tense, I am sending; their mission has already begun (Joh 17:9); and the first part of it was to be the proclamation of the truth just brought home to themselves—the Resurrection (Act 1:22; Act 2:32; Act 4:2; Act 4:33, &c.).
